Former Undisputed WWE Universal Champion Roman Reigns has certainly cemented his place as one of the greatest WWE superstars of all time. However, the era of the ‘Tribal Chief’ ended at WrestleMania 40 PLE as Cody Rhodes dethroned him and captured the Undisputed WWE Championship.
Ever since that disastrous night, The Tribal Chief has not appeared on WWE live television. He also pulled himself out of the pool for the WWE Draft. Solo Sikoa, who was announced as ‘The Tribal Heir’, has been leading The Bloodline in Roman Reigns’ absence.
It has come to light that during his hiatus, Reigns was seen filming a movie called “Good Fortune” with a cast of Hollywood actors. The movie recently finished production. There have been many speculations about Roman Reigns’ return to WWE happening sooner than anticipated and him reclaiming his top position.
Interestingly, WWE is advertising him for SmackDown before SummerSlam this year. It seems that the fans shouldn’t expect to see Roman Reigns return to WWE anytime soon.
Ringside News reported that they reached out to a WWE writing team member regarding the rumors about Roman Reigns, who stated that people in WWE have not heard anything about the subject and doubted if those rumors were even true.
